Zaselim Posted February 18, 2013 Author Posted February 18, 2013 What you probably need to do is (assuming your modified body is based on CBBEv3 so it has same poly count): -get TBBP body (weight painted) - http://www.loverslab.com/topic/9289-rel-new-updates-nov-28th-tender-bbp-a-new-bbp-simulation/ -get XP32 maximum skeleton (for modders?) - http://skyrim.nexusmods.com/mods/26800 Open TBBP body, copy SKIN modifier Open your modified body CBBEv3 body Import maximum skeleton Paste SKIN modifier onto your body Upload your modified body on mediafire And share it with us!
